Информация
Услуги
  • Внедрение
  • Настройка
  • Поддержка
  • Ремонт
Контакты
Оплата
Новости
Доставка
Загрузки
Форум
Настройка
    info@proxmox.su
    +7 (495) 320-70-49
    Заказать звонок
    Аспро: ЛайтШоп
    Войти
    0 Сравнение
    0 Избранное
    0 Корзина
    Аспро: ЛайтШоп
    Войти
    0 Сравнение
    0 Избранное
    0 Корзина
    Аспро: ЛайтШоп
    Телефоны
    +7 (495) 320-70-49
    Заказать звонок
    0
    0
    0
    Аспро: ЛайтШоп
    • +7 (495) 320-70-49
      • Назад
      • Телефоны
      • +7 (495) 320-70-49
      • Заказать звонок
    • info@proxmox.su
    • Москва, Бакунинская улица, 69с1
    • Пн-Пт: 09-00 до 18-00
      Сб-Вс: выходной
    • 0 Сравнение
    • 0 Избранное
    • 0 Корзина
    Главная
    Форум
    Proxmox Виртуальная Среда
    noVNC подключается к гостевой ВМ без портала

    Форумы: Proxmox Виртуальная Среда, Proxmox Backup Server, Proxmox Mail Gateway, Proxmox Datacenter Manager
    Поиск  Пользователи  Правила  Войти
    Страницы: 1
    RSS
    noVNC подключается к гостевой ВМ без портала, Proxmox Виртуальная Среда
     
    timur
    Guest
    #1
    0
    01.10.2014 14:10:00
    Привет! Кто-нибудь может объяснить, возможно ли подключиться к гостевой виртуалке через браузер без доступа к админ-порталу (https://blah-blah.com:8006)? Я имею в виду, что клиент (%username%) должен иметь доступ к своей ВМ через http, https://blah-blah.com:5901, где blah-blah.com — это сервер Proxmox 3.3-2, а порт 5901 уже проброшен на конкретную ВМ. Такое подключение работает, но только через клиент, например tigervnc. Мне нужно проверить, возможно ли подключение через novnc. Спасибо!
     
     
     
    MicJB
    Guest
    #2
    0
    02.03.2015 16:38:00
    Я просто хочу отметить, что ссылка, о которой идет речь, НЕ работает ни у кого другого, потому что она запускается на том же сервере, что и Proxmox, и поэтому установка куки проходит без проблем. Однако, как уже неоднократно говорили, если у вас есть свой собственный веб-приложение, сайт или сервис, то вам не повезло, так как куки не могут устанавливаться между разными сайтами, и метод аутентификации через куки, который использует Proxmox, проваливается именно в тот момент, когда это нужно больше всего. Буду рад, если меня поправят и докажут обратное. Думаю, это можно исправить просто добавив в API точку входа, куда можно посылать куки, чтобы они устанавливались на стороне сервера через API Proxmox.
     
     
     
    dietmar
    Guest
    #3
    0
    02.03.2015 17:03:00
    Cookie — это просто обычный HTML-заголовок, так что достаточно просто добавить этот заголовок к API-запросам...
     
     
     
    alatteri
    Guest
    #4
    0
    02.03.2015 17:44:00
    Установите Hamachi VPN и XRDP на ваших гостевых машинах... тогда вам не нужно будет ничего делать с самим Proxmox, так как удалённый доступ полностью обрабатывается гостевой виртуальной машиной.
     
     
     
    MicJB
    Guest
    #5
    0
    02.03.2015 18:43:00
    Спасибо, dietmar, я согласен, что API-вызовы работают отлично. К сожалению, здесь не в этом проблема. Проблема в открытии URL консоли ВМ через стандартную ссылку, например open vm console, которая не срабатывает, потому что NoVNC жалуется на отсутствие тикета. Дело в том, что ссылка находится на сайте A, а сервер proxmox — на сервере B, и никто, кроме сервера B, не может установить *браузерный* куки для сервера B. Как отметил timur, это бы сработало, если бы пользователь был залогинен в proxmox на сервере B — тогда нужный куки в браузере установлен, и переход по ссылке приведёт сразу к proxmox с уже выставленным куки. Значит, чтобы добиться этого, нам, по-моему, нужно либо программно логинить пользователей через API-вызов, либо иметь API, который напрямую устанавливает браузерный куки на стороне сервера по заданным учётным данным. Первая опция, скорее всего, лучше, потому что позволит сторонним веб-приложениям более плавно интегрироваться с proxmox.
     
     
     
    MicJB
    Guest
    #6
    0
    02.03.2015 18:46:00
    Интересно, но, похоже, это нам не подходит, так как нам нужен доступ к консоли виртуальных машин независимо от того, что пользователь установил или удалил в своих виртуальных машинах.
     
     
     
    MicJB
    Guest
    #7
    0
    01.03.2015 01:37:00
    Кто-нибудь уже нашёл решение этой проблемы? У меня такая же ситуация, как и у timur: нужно программно войти под пользователем, не открывая для него GUI Proxmox.
     
     
     
    Phinitris
    Guest
    #8
    0
    01.03.2015 14:35:00
    Привет, Proxmox поддерживает это из коробки. Не нужно менять API. Вы двое можете добавить меня в Skype: henne.s. С наилучшими пожеланиями, Генри.
     
     
     
    Страницы: 1
    Читают тему
    +7 (495) 320-70-49
    info@proxmox.su

    Конфиденциальность Оферта
    © 2026 Proxmox.su
    Главная Каталог 0 Корзина 0 Избранные Кабинет 0 Сравнение Акции Контакты Услуги Бренды Отзывы Компания Лицензии Документы Реквизиты Поиск Блог Обзоры